About EBOPRAS: what it means for a facelift patient

The European Board of Plastic, Reconstructive and Aesthetic Surgery (EBOPRAS) is the European board-examination body for plastic surgery, operating under the European Union of Medical Specialists (UEMS).

EBOPRAS runs a European board examination open to plastic surgeons who have completed, or are completing, recognised specialty training in a European country. Surgeons who pass are entitled to use the title Fellow of EBOPRAS (FEBOPRAS). The examination is a voluntary European benchmark taken on top of national specialist registration — each country's medical authority remains the body that licenses surgeons.

On DEEPPLANE™, EBOPRAS and FEBOPRAS listings are treated as one credential, since the fellowship title is earned by passing the EBOPRAS examination. For patients comparing surgeons across European countries, it is a useful common benchmark — but always confirm the surgeon's national specialist registration in the country where they operate.

How to verify a surgeon's EBOPRAS status

  1. Confirm the surgeon's EBOPRAS/FEBOPRAS status via ebopras.eu.
  2. Verify national specialist registration with the medical authority of the country where the surgeon practises — the licence, not the fellowship, is what permits them to operate.

Does holding EBOPRAS guarantee a good deep plane facelift?
No. EBOPRAS is one signal of formal training or standing, not a guarantee of outcome, and credentialing systems differ by country. Weigh it alongside the surgeon's deep-plane case volume, before-and-after results, and independent reviews — and always confirm current status and licensure before booking, especially when travelling abroad.
